In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. However, the area surrounding M14 5PY is primarily male, with 54.8% of the population being male. Several factors can contribute to this, including areas with industries or sectors that predominantly employ men, proximity to universities or technical schools with a higher enrollment of male students, presence of all-male or predominantly male institutions (military academies, boarding schools).
| 2011 | 2021 | 10y change (pp) | UK Average | postcode vs UK (pp) |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Female | 43.1% | 45.2% | 2.1% | 51.0% | -5.8% |
| Male | 56.9% | 54.8% | -2.1% | 49.0% | 5.8% |
Across the UK, the average relationship status breakdown is roughly 44% married, 38% single, 9% divorced, 6% widowed, and 2% separated.
In the immediate area around M14 5PY, a significant portion of the population is single, making up 74.9% of the residents. On average, approximately 38% of individuals who responded to the census in the UK were single. Areas with higher single populations are typically urban centers, university towns, regions with dynamic job markets, rich cultural offerings and entertainment facilities. These regions also tend to have a younger demographic.
| 2011 | 2021 | 10y change (pp) | UK Average | postcode vs UK (pp) |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Single | 77.1% | 74.9% | -2.2% | 37.9% | 37.0% |
| Married: Opposite sex | 16.8% | 18.8% | 2.0% | 44.2% | -25.4% |
| Separated | 1.2% | 0.8% | -0.4% | 2.2% | -1.4% |
| Divorced | 2.2% | 2.7% | 0.5% | 9.1% | -6.4% |
| Widowed | 2.7% | 2.7% | 0.0% | 6.1% | -3.4% |
